‘Bambo’: Joey King In Talks For Natasha Lyonne-Directed 1980s Boxing Pic Produced By Craig Mazin

Former “Poker Face” star Natasha Lyonne (the Rian Johnson murder mystery series will be moving on with Peter Dinklage as it’s being shopped around after exiting Peacock) has delayed her gestating AI world project to focus on the boxing drama “Bambo,” making this her feature film directing debut with a story set in the world of boxing during the 1980s.

Now, there is a word from Deadline that actress Joey King is being courted and is in active talks to play the titular role of Sophie “Bambo” Braverman, the nickname given to her by her seedy boxing promoter father, Gideon, as a shortened version of Baby Rambo (a reference to the Sly Stallone action film franchise).

The film’s synopsis, as described by the outlet’s report:

“Set in the ’80s and follows a Brooklyn-born boxing-promoter father as he tries and fails to become the next Don King and takes his kid daughter along for the hurly burly ride of tax evasion, cocaine, race cars, lost dreams, and heartbreak.”

However, they stress that a deal hasn’t been signed for King, but with their aim to get cameras rolling sometime in the summer on “Bambo,” they have time to iron out a contract. Lyonne also produces via her production banner Animal Pictures with Max Ferguson alongside Craig Mazin for Word Games, Jason Weinberg, and Sarah Sarandos.

King’s previous film credits include “Bullet Train,” “A Family Affair,” “Uglies,” “The Conjuring,” and a minor role in “The Dark Knight Rises.”

It remains to be seen who Lyonne will be casting as Bambo’s erratic father, which will be the other main role in the father-daughter story. We’ll keep our fingers crossed that actors like Bobby Cannavale, Jon Bernthal, or Will Arnett (folks we could imagine paired up with King) are potentially considered for that meaty part of Gideon, unless they already have someone else in mind (a likelihood).
